Are the New England Revolution a team of destiny?

It’s a question worth asking, as the team embarks on an improbable run through the 2020 MLS Cup playoffs. Having beaten the Montreal Impact, Philadelphia Union and Orlando City in recent weeks, New England will visit the Columbus Crew on Sunday in the Eastern Conference Final, looking to reach the MLS Cup Final for the sixth time in their history.

On this week’s episode of the “NESN Soccer Podcast,” Marc DiBenedetto and Marcus Kwesi O’Mard discuss the Cinderella story the Revolution seem to be authoring. They also discuss the life and legacy of Diego Maradona, who died last week at age 60.
